The Importance of Grooming

As cat owners, we know that our feline friends require regular grooming to stay healthy and happy. But did you know that grooming is also a crucial aspect of their social behavior? In the wild, cats use scent marking to communicate with each other, and domesticated cats are no exception. By keeping your cat's coat clean and well-maintained, you're not only improving their physical health but also strengthening your bond with them.

Grooming is an essential part of a cat's daily routine, and neglecting it can lead to serious health issues. As a responsible pet owner, it's crucial to establish a regular grooming schedule that includes nail trimming, ear cleaning, and brushing their beautiful coats.

Tips for Styling Your Cat's Coat

As cat owners, we know that our feline friends have unique personalities and quirks. When it comes to styling their coats, it's essential to consider these individual traits and adapt your approach accordingly. For example, some cats may require more frequent brushing due to their thick or curly coats, while others may need less attention in certain areas.
